Federal and Provincial/Territorial Tax Brackets
Your taxable income in the following tax brackets.
Federal Tax Bracket | Federal Tax Rates |
---|---|
$57,375.00 or less | 15% |
$57,375.00 - $114,749.99 | 20.5% |
$114,750.00 - $177,881.99 | 26% |
$177,882.00 - $253,413.99 | 29% |
More than $253,414.00 | 33% |
Nova Scotia Tax Bracket | Nova Scotia Tax Rates |
---|---|
$30,507.00 or less | 8.79% |
$30,507.00 - $61,014.99 | 14.95% |
$61,015.00 - $95,882.99 | 16.67% |
$95,883.00 - $154,649.99 | 17.5% |
More than $154,650.00 | 21% |

Region | Total Income | Total Deductions | Net Pay | Avg. Tax Rate | Comp. Deduction Rate |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
Nunavut | $148,800.00 | $40,038.24 | $108,761.76 | 23.21% | 26.91% |
Yukon | $148,800.00 | $42,560.59 | $106,239.41 | 24.9% | 28.6% |
British Columbia | $148,800.00 | $43,020.44 | $105,779.56 | 25.21% | 28.91% |
Northwest Territories | $148,800.00 | $43,117.88 | $105,682.12 | 25.28% | 28.98% |
Alberta | $148,800.00 | $43,627.88 | $105,172.12 | 25.62% | 29.32% |
Ontario | $148,800.00 | $46,254.38 | $102,545.62 | 27.38% | 31.08% |
Saskatchewan | $148,800.00 | $46,494.95 | $102,305.05 | 27.55% | 31.25% |
New Brunswick | $148,800.00 | $49,143.56 | $99,656.44 | 29.33% | 33.03% |
Manitoba | $148,800.00 | $49,478.26 | $99,321.74 | 29.55% | 33.25% |
Newfoundland and Labrador | $148,800.00 | $49,873.39 | $98,926.61 | 29.82% | 33.52% |
Prince Edward Island | $148,800.00 | $51,570.60 | $97,229.40 | 30.96% | 34.66% |
Quebec | $148,800.00 | $52,557.82 | $96,242.18 | 31.24% | 35.32% |
Nova Scotia | $148,800.00 | $52,580.23 | $96,219.77 | 31.63% | 35.34% |
